First things first, let's talk about the size of this place. The Bellagio is a massive 36-story hotel with over 3,900 rooms. That's right, we said 3,900. So, if you're planning on exploring every nook and cranny of this place, you're going to need some comfortable shoes and a lot of caffeine.

Now, let's talk about the layout. The Bellagio is split into two main towers, the Spa Tower and the Bellagio Tower. Each tower has its own set of elevators, which can make navigating the hotel a bit confusing at first. But don't worry, just take a deep breath and remember that getting lost is half the fun.

If you're looking for some high-end shopping, the Bellagio has got you covered. The Via Bellagio shopping promenade is located just off the main lobby and features some of the most luxurious shops in Las Vegas. From Gucci to Prada, you'll find everything you need to max out your credit card.

But let's be real, the main attraction at the Bellagio is the casino. With over 116,000 square feet of gaming space, you could spend days in here and still not see everything. From blackjack to roulette, the Bellagio has it all. And if you're feeling lucky, head over to the high limit slots area and try your hand at winning big.

One of the most iconic features of the Bellagio is the Fountains of Bellagio. Located in front of the hotel, these fountains put on a spectacular show every 30 minutes from 3 pm to 8 pm and every 15 minutes from 8 pm to midnight. Trust us when we say that watching the fountains dance to music is a sight you won't soon forget.

Another must-see attraction at the Bellagio is the Conservatory & Botanical Gardens. This indoor garden features seasonal displays made up of thousands of flowers and plants. From Chinese New Year to Christmas, the Conservatory is always decked out in its finest flora.

If you're looking for a little R&R, head over to the Bellagio Spa. With over 65,000 square feet of space, this spa has everything you need to relax and rejuvenate. From massages to facials, you'll leave feeling like a brand new person.
